In the hinterland of the Gulf of Diano Marina, in a small historic center surrounded by greenery, we offer a typical Ligurian-style stone house, spread over two levels (plus a warehouse) with large outdoor spaces and a private garden.
We are in Camporondo, a small hamlet in the municipality of Diano San Pietro, nestled among verdant hills covered in centuries-old olive trees and Mediterranean scrub, where narrow alleys called "carruggi" wind between brightly colored, well-maintained houses.
The property has very deep historical roots in the past and every corner of it unequivocally confirms these origins.
The house is spread over two floors
On the first floor, the main entrance to the house, there is a large living room with a corner wood-burning fireplace, a built-in kitchenette, a hallway, and a bathroom. The hallway leads to the covered terrace, from which a staircase leads down to the garden.
The second floor features a large hallway, two bedrooms, and a bathroom with a window. Direct access to the public driveway is also possible from the second floor.
On the ground floor/basement there is a spacious cellar, a small porch with a wood-burning oven and a private garden.
The property enjoys sunshine for much of the day and offers sweeping views of the surrounding green hills and the sea.
The private garden is approximately 100 m2 and it is possible to evaluate a driveway to arrive directly inside the property with your own car.
Alternatively, at the entrance to the village there is a parking lot where you can park freely.
A house for true history lovers, but also for those who love tranquility, both as a holiday home and as a residence.
Ideal for those who love the charm of Ligurian villages and the peace that reigns there.
